What is an Orangery?
Before diving into the top-rated installers, it is very important to understand what an orangery is. Generally, Professional Orangery Builders was a structure designed to secure orange trees during the cold weather. Nowadays, they are more typically used as stylish extensions to homes, including large windows, bi-fold doors, and typically a lantern roofing. Unlike a conservatory, which is predominantly made from glass, an orangery normally has a mix of brickwork and glass, permitting greater thermal efficiency and a more strong structure.

Regularly Asked Questions
1. For how long does it require to build an orangery?
The timeframe for building an orangery can differ depending on the size and complexity of the design, but normally, it can take anywhere from 6 to 12 weeks. Constantly go over timelines with your chosen installer.
2. Do I require preparing permission for an orangery?
In many cases, an orangery can be developed under allowed development rights. Nevertheless, if you reside in a sanctuary or if your residential or commercial property is listed, you may need planning permission. It's best to inspect with your local council.
3. What is the typical expense of an orangery?
The cost can vary widely based on design, size, materials, and place. Generally,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 15,000 and ₤ 40,000 for a quality orangery.
4. Can I use my orangery year-round?
Yes, modern orangeries are designed with thermal effectiveness in mind, which permits for comfortable use throughout the year, though additional heating or cooling options may boost comfort depending upon the environment.
5. What types of finishes are readily available?
Orangeries can be ended up in different styles, including standard, contemporary, and modern. Typical products consist of brick, stone, and top quality glazing.
